numberFire is the next generation sports analytics platform. We take the unstructured and misleading data that exists all around sports and mine it for unprecedented insight that allows us to predict player and team performance better than any competitor. The first step of our process involves digging into the box score. We know that it means a lot more to throw for 300 yards against the a good defense than a bad one, so why simply use yards as an indicator for how good a quarterback is? Using a series of mathematical models, we break down the action in order to have a better and more accurate understanding of what teams and players are performing well and which are paper champions. The next step of process involves using the power of predictive and regressive modeling to more accurately project future performance. Using our advanced metrics combined with state-of-the-art predictive algorithms, we leverage the power of science to come up with the most accurate, data-driven projections around. Since founding the company in 2010, weve grown the community to over 120,000 users, and forged major partnerships with ESPN, Sports Illustrated, Bleacher Report, SB Nation, and SLAM. numberFire was acquired by FanDuel in August 2015.
